The importance of strategy

Card games like solitaire offer more than just entertainment; they are a challenge to your mind and planning skills. Rather than relying on chance, strategic players can increase their chances by making smart moves. The ability to think through possible moves in advance adds depth and complexity to your game. This can be especially beneficial in competitive environments where every move counts.

Strategy means recognising the patterns in the game and adapting your moves accordingly. It requires patience and the ability to remain calm even in difficult situations. If you have a good understanding of the rules and mechanisms of the game, you can develop targeted strategies. This turns seemingly random sequences of cards into opportunities for targeted attacks on the playing field.

Many players underestimate the depth of a game like Solitaire. But if you are prepared to delve deeper into strategic thinking, you will soon realise that every decision can trigger a chain reaction. This realisation is what makes strategy so appealing and takes the game to a new level.

Develop skills

To improve your strategic skills, continuous practice is essential. The more often you play and try out different strategies, the better you will become at mastering complex game situations. Concentrate on planning ahead and always thinking one step ahead.

Decision-making plays a central role in strategic play. Learn from every move and adapt your strategies accordingly. It is important to keep both short-term and long-term goals in mind. Even if a move does not bring immediate success, it could be decisive later on.

You should also regularly learn new techniques and apply them to your game. By exchanging ideas with other players or studying expert strategies, you can gain valuable insights and optimise your own game.

Tips for improvement

Consistency is the key to success in skill-based card games. Make sure you play regularly to develop a feel for the game and try out new strategies. Recording your games can help you recognise and avoid mistakes.

One of the best tips is to always stay focused and not get discouraged by setbacks. Every mistake offers a learning opportunity and brings you closer to your goal. Also train your ability to adapt - react flexibly to unforeseen twists and turns in the game.

Make sure your environment is free from distractions. A calm environment allows you to concentrate fully on the game and make better decisions. In the long run, this will not only improve your understanding of the game, but also your chances of success.
